    This unit focuses on the safe and efficient preparation and operation of tower cranes during construction installation tasks, ensuring compliance with workplace procedures, contract specifications, and legislative requirements. Learners must demonstrate the ability to interpret technical information, conduct pre-use checks, and operate the crane to lift and position loads precisely, while maintaining communication with the lifting team.

    Assessment Criteria

    Key criteria assessors look for in your portfolio

    • Award credit for demonstrating a thorough pre-operation inspection of the tower crane, including checks on structural integrity, safety devices, and load charts, with any defects reported and recorded.
    • Credit must be given for clear evidence of interpreting and following the specific lifting plan, contract specifications, and any site-specific method statements or risk assessments.
    • Learners should show consistent use of standard hand signals or radio communication with the slinger/signaller, maintaining safe control during all phases of lifting.
    • Evidence of correctly calculating load weights, radius, and height, and ensuring the crane is set up within its safe working load (SWL) for the configuration used.
    • Award credit for adhering to exclusion zones, managing weather conditions, and complying with LOLER and PUWER regulations throughout operations.

    Common Mistakes

    Common errors to avoid in your coursework

    • Failing to conduct a thorough visual inspection of the crane's structural components, wire ropes, and safety devices before operation.
    • Misinterpreting the lifting plan, leading to loads being lifted beyond the crane's rated capacity or reach for that setup.
    • Ignoring environmental factors such as wind speed limits for tower cranes, which can lead to dangerous instability.
    • Not establishing clear communication protocols with the signalling team, resulting in misunderstandings and unsafe maneuvering.
    • Overlooking the need to verify ground conditions or crane foundation adequacy before setup, which can cause overturning risks.
    • Misconception: Plant installation is just about physically placing equipment. Correction: It involves detailed planning, interpretation of technical data, and precise alignment to manufacturer specifications, often requiring teamwork and problem-solving.
    • Misconception: Health and safety paperwork is optional for experienced workers. Correction: All installations must comply with legal requirements, and thorough risk assessments and method statements are mandatory, regardless of experience level.
    • Misconception: Testing is only needed after installation is complete. Correction: Testing should be carried out at various stages, such as during foundation setting and after connections, to identify issues early and avoid costly rework.
